About the opportunity:
Our client has an exciting opportunity for the right candidate to join their business servicing local and international clients. This could suit a Refrigeration Engineer with commissioning and PLC experience who wants to progress in the industry and travel.
The base location is in beautiful Marlborough, and if this isn’t enough, the company offers a welcoming team environment and a can-do culture that celebrates success and rewards performance. Great incentives are offered to ensure you live more than comfortably.
Responsibilities will include:
Working as a Refrigeration Engineer, you will be in the freeze-dry department and be trained as a Freeze Dry Commissioning Engineer. This position will have you split your time between the Blenheim workshop (building the dryers and factory acceptance testing) and client sites worldwide (commissioning new machines, servicing and fault-finding existing machines).
A strong professional manner is essential, given this is a client-facing position. This role will require you to be away from home for a few weeks, but with a wider team and careful project planning, you will be based in Blenheim for most of the year.
This role will suit someone with all or some following background/experience/qualities:
Fully qualified refrigeration engineer
Practical background experience in engineering systems and disciplines
C02 experience would be an advantage
Strong skills in working autonomously on technically complex projects
Proficient in electrics, controls, PC applications, and information systems
Have high standards of quality and customer service
Strong communications skills, both verbally and written
About the company:
Our client has been proudly based in the heart of the Marlborough region for over 80 years. They are known locally and globally for their engineering innovation, quality and service. Their services range from general engineering and freeze-dry technologies to water engineering, refrigeration and air conditioning. The freeze-dry division has successfully delivered over 400 freeze-dry systems in more than 20 countries, ranging from small test batch dryers to multi-tonne projects for various applications, all designed and built in Blenheim, New Zealand.
